## Escalation: Retention Sweeper Stalls

If the Pruneline sweeper falls more than two cycles behind, first verify the tombstone queue depth in the Harvest dashboard. A depth above 50k usually means the legal-hold filter is re-evaluating every record; do not restart the worker, as partial sweeps can orphan audit markers. Pause the schedule, snapshot the cursor state, and record both values in the incident log. If the backlog persists past thirty minutes, escalate to the Dataguard retention team directly.

escalation mailbox, bafog-fafog: ulador@paliqlabs.internal

CI note for Fernbrook contractors: if the template-render benchmark fails, check whether the partial cache was warmed. The Quillset runner starts cold, so the first render always exceeds the 200ms budget; only the second pass counts. Rerun with the warmup flag before escalating. The token of the last passing build is below.

pipeline stamp: htk3_69f

## Deployment

Welcome aboard! Shipping Graphlet (our dependency graph visualizer) is pretty painless. It's a single Node service plus a static frontend bundle — build both with `make dist`, then push the image to the Korvane internal registry and bump the tag in the deploy repo. Staging auto-deploys on merge; prod needs a thumbs-up from whoever's on rotation that week. Don't worry about the graph database, it's managed separately. The service reads its settings at boot, shown below.

settings of tagef-bawif:
DRUIX_HOST=druix.zemvarlabs.internal
DRUIX_PORT=8000